Abstract
The invention discloses a kind of floating type garages, including outer frame, suspension frame for parking and move frame structure, the bottom plate that the outer frame is equipped with the servo motor with band-type brake and is in immediately below suspension frame for parking, suspension frame for parking includes parking plate, apical axis and several truck frames being arranged on parking plate, apical axis is fixed by connecting rod rest and suspension frame for parking, moving frame structure includes two pivoted levers being arranged symmetrically, suspension frame for parking is between two pivoted levers, pivoted lever one end is equipped with the bearing being cooperatively connected with apical axis, and one of pivoted lever is equipped with the mandrel driven by servo motor.Be not in interference in height and horizontal direction the beneficial effects of the present invention are: realizing that vehicle access position is converted in the form of suspension lifting, holding level can be ensured in the conversion process of vehicle access position, can maintain to stablize after converting.

Background technique
Traditional indoor bicycle parking area is mostly flush system garage or lifting garage, and flush system garage is opposite to be taken up a large area, vehicle
Park negligible amounts.Although lifting garage improves opposite parking capacity, but when carrying out upper and lower level conversion, lower layer is needed to have
Enough avoiding spaces, and when each upper-layer parking structure decline, need lower layer's parking structure is mobile to step down, once it deploys
Mistake, the bicycle that will lead on upper-layer parking structure and lower layer's parking structure are damaged.

At the beginning, suspension frame for parking is in top.When work, start servo motor, drive central axis, mandrel drives pivoted lever to turn
Dynamic, so that apical axis is started turning along mandrel, so that suspension frame for parking also starts turning decline, and the inner ring due to bearing and apical axis are same
Axis is fixed, and since suspension frame for parking itself has gravity, so during rotation, suspension frame for parking in addition to can around mandrel " revolution ",
It can also be around apical axis " rotation ", so suspension frame for parking (parking plate) can maintain a stable state.Parking plate turns to lower section
Afterwards, contact base plate, can carry out picking up the car at this time or bicycle parking, and when bicycle parking, bicycle is pushed into a truck frame, is picked up the car
When, bicycle is pulled out from a upper truck frame.And after the completion of bicycle parking, servo motor can be allowed to drive suspension frame for parking multiple
Position is not take up lower space so that bicycle be retractd aloft.

Parking plate initial angle and center of gravity are can be designed, and preferably selection is: parking plate keeps horizontal or close
Horizontality (using the perpendicular where apical axis axis as symmetrical centre, the structured whole weight of institute on suspension frame for parking and suspension frame for parking
The heart is fallen in the symmetrical centre).But bicycle center of gravity usually belongs to top-heavy type (front-wheel lateral deviation not at center
Weight), and in bicycle parking to parking plate, after parking plate completion uphill process, parking plate is easily tilted, is shaken, stability and peace
Full property is lacking.In the present embodiment, counter weight construction is pre-set, it, can be with thus after in bicycle parking to parking plate
Ensure that whole center of gravity is fallen in place, to ensure that the parking plate holding after rising is horizontal, but this occurs one and asks again
Topic, it may be assumed that the final position of clump weight is the position of centre of gravity after all being stopped on parking plate according to all bicycles well to determine, this
It results in, bicycle must be fully parked on parking plate, could rise and store up, otherwise still will lead to parking plate inclination, shake.These
Big inconvenience will be caused to vehicle access, also result in security risk.
And in the present embodiment: devising a kind of counter weight construction that can carry out position cooperation automatically.When not parking bicycle
When, clump weight present position can ensure that whole position of centre of gravity falls in symmetrical centre and (is with the perpendicular where apical axis axis
Symmetrical centre) in, and in bicycle parking to parking plate and in place after, a corresponding clump weight can be with shift position to setting
Point, to continue to ensure that whole position of centre of gravity is fallen in symmetrical centre.Process is as follows, and a bicycle is pushed into a truck frame
When, counter weight construction corresponding with the truck frame will appear following variation: by Fig. 3 into Fig. 6 for visual angle, pushing plate is by bicycle
Front-wheel promotion moves to right, and drives and piston is pushed to move to right, and a part of hydraulic oil in oil pocket is pushed to enter through oil pipe from steady oil pocket, thus
It is moved to left from steady piston, clump weight is driven to move to left, after bicycle push-in in place (front-wheel touches joint plate), clump weight reaches new
Center of gravity setting position, whole position of centre of gravity is fallen in symmetrical centre at this time.And it resets be in tensional state at this time, and due to
Ejector pin on clump weight has reached immediately below reset hole, and under the effect of pin spring, ejector pin upper end enters reset hole, locating part upper end
It stretches out outside parking plate upper face.Ejector pin has then positioned clump weight.Similarly, after often thering is a bicycle to be pushed into place, all can
There is corresponding clump weight mobile in place.And when picking up the car, operator's drawing bicycle leaves parking plate, and wheel can push release link,
Release link pushes ejector pin, away from reset hole, under action of reset spring, and counterweight block reset, while by from steady bar band
It moves from steady piston reset, enters promotion oil pocket through oil pipe from a part of hydraulic oil in steady oil pocket, push sheet reset.To sum up institute
It says, the access of bicycle is free on parking plate, no matter having deposited several vehicles, can be ensured horizontal, stable after parking plate rises.
In addition, this programme also has an effect: after front wheel enters push-in truck frame and contacts pushing plate, if will not voluntarily
Vehicle pushes in place completely, so that reset spring can play reset always if ejector pin upper end enters reset hole, limits clump weight
Effect, and pushing plate is driven to be pushed outwardly bicycle, allow bicycle to leave truck frame.So this programme, which can ensure to allow, to be made
Bicycle is pushed into place by user, accurately to control whole center of gravity, and ensures that bicycle can be accurately positioned in the position set.
